Continue ReadingThe high school season is ramping up district play and there are some players that are scoring at will all over the court. These young ladies cannot be stopped. They are scoring in bunches for their varsity squads and no one has been able to slow them down. This series of articles will be highlighting players in every grade level who are filling up the stat books. We are going to continue with the sensational senior class and give props to the attackers who are leading the entire state in kills. Please help us recognize the following players.
Evyn Snook Evyn Snook 6'1" | OH Magnolia West | 2023 State TX [2023] 6-2 Outside (HS: Magnolia West/Club: Texas Tornados / Verbal: UT at Artlington)
Evyn is currently listed as the 77th best overall prospect in the 2023 class according to our Prep Dig Texas State Rankings. She is a true six-rotation pin hitter from Magnolia West High School and also from Texas Tornados Volleyball club. She has been a super consistent scoring threat for her varsity squad for the last four years. She stepped onto the scene as a freshman and has not stopped her production since. This year has been her best year by far on the offensive end. She has a career best 520 kills on a great .224 hitting percentage. Miss Snook will take her talents to the University of Texas at Arlington next season, but we are enjoying her one last time. For her career, she is sitting at 1,351 kills and not many can say that. When this young lady gets on top of the ball, watch out! She has incredible power and is already playing at a division one college level. She has an uncanny ability to move the ball around the block no matter where they are. It is due to some amazing court vision that UTA will love next year.
Kenna Buchanan [2023] 5-10 Outside (HS: Midlothian/Club: Dallas Skyline/Verbal: Texas A&M at Corpus Christi)
Kenna is currently an unranked prospect in the 2023 class according to our Texas State Rankings, but has been on my watch list for a while now and she should have no problem making the list when I update it. She plays for Midlothian High School and also for Dallas Skyline. Another four-year starter who has been terrorizing opponents all this time. She is having one heck of a senior year by tallying 499 kills on a whopping .382 hitting percentage. The A&M Corpus Christi commit will make an immediate impact on their roster from the moment she steps on campus. While she might not be over 6 ft tall like some of her counterparts, this young lady lives above the net and scores in bunches due to her remarkable speed and amazing ability to adjust her footwork to the ball. Midlothian loves to bring her inside to the 3 and 5 position along the net to score during play sets. Her amazing footwork puts her in a perfect position to kill the ball. She is a flat out stud on the court and we are proud to have covered her career.
Blaire Bayless Blaire Bayless 6'2" | OH Plano West | 2023 State #63 Nation TX [2023] 6-2 Outside (HS: Plano West/Club: Madfrog /Verbal: University of Pittsburgh)
Blaire is currently listed as the 13th best overall prospect according to the 2023 Prep Dig Texas State Rankings. She plays at Plano West high school and also club for the famed Madfrog volleyball club. We have covered her numerous times over the past couple of years and she still continues to be one of the best players in the state. She has tallied 495 kills on a .305 hitting percentage during her senior season. Blaire is a woman playing against girls out there on the hardwood. She is a lethal threat to score from any location on the court at any time. If you have not seen her play, you are missing out on an absolutely picturesque approach to the ball. We will be cheering her on as she suits up for Pitt next season all the way from Texas. In the meantime, we are loving watching her for one last time.
